The Office of Undergraduate Research and Scholarship (OURS), a program within the Center for Undergraduate Scholar Engagement (CUSE), provides support for undergraduates to pursue research and creative practice in their discipline. Essentially, we support curious students, by connecting them with ways to discover, research, and explore. Students work with faculty on student-initiated, or faculty-initiated research and creative practice. OURS provides support for all students interested in research or scholar opportunities, from exploratory students to advanced student researchers/ scholars. Learn more about OURS.
